ESTIMATOR / PROJECT MANAGER

Hiring for both locations- Warwick, ON & London, ON)

Client has been in the forefront of shaping the face of communities and farms in Southwestern Ontario. They provide high quality site preparation, land development and construction integration services.

Our services are in sand & gravel, recycling, land development, farm / municipal drainage and sewer & watermain.

RESPONSIBILITIES :

  • We are looking for a team player with solid communication skills (both verbal and written).
  • A driven individual with a passion for the contractor environment
  • Experienced in Civil Engineering or Construction Management.
  • Excellent organizational and analytical skills and are committed to building strong business relationships with clients and sub-contractors.
  • Prepare construction estimates based on quotations, drawings, and specifications.
  • Create and track construction project schedules.
  • Visit worksites to monitor progress and maintain communication with the Foreman running the site.
  • Assist in preparation of pre-construction and construction services proposals.
  • Examine and analyze tenders and make recommendations.
  • Follow the company cost monitoring and reporting systems and procedures.
  • Liaise, consult, and communicate with consultants, contractors, and subcontractors.
  • Research and analyze cost data for review and presentation.
  • Adhere to all company policies and procedures while following OHSA and construction regulations.

QUALIFICATIONS :

  • Civil Engineering or Construction Management diploma is an asset.
  • Proven experience in estimating within the civil construction industry.
  • Computer skills and software experience including Microsoft Office Applications.
  • Experience with Bid2Win, Heavy Bid, Acumatica, or Maestro is an asset.
  • Excellent organizational skills and ability to meet deadlines.
  • Excellent analytical skills and attention to details.
  • Knowledge of MTO book 7 Traffic Control Requirements.
  • Experience with hazard assessments and controls in the construction industry.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ills.
